Re: bad gas mileage

O2 sensor is the most often culprit.
Air intake filter. Of course theres the usual things like missing and the like.
There are things that some do to help like facing the plugs.

However not from your issues of one day to the next or after a repair job. I hope you havent got a new vacuum leak.

21 Mpg in the city is great.. actually 27 highway only is whats been experienced.

I have heard of lower mileages when running Ethanol too since it has a lower energy available when it burns.
